Understanding the Role of 3PL Providers
Third-party logistics (3PL) providers play a pivotal role in the ecommerce fulfillment landscape. By outsourcing logistics to specialized providers, businesses can focus on their core competencies while ensuring that their shipping and fulfillment needs are met efficiently.
Many ecommerce brands benefit from partnering with 3PLs who offer scalable solutions tailored to their specific needs. This partnership allows for greater flexibility in operations, especially during peak seasons, enabling brands to adapt quickly to changing market demands.
